10 Year Interest Only Rates Banks With The Lowest Mortgage Rates The average rate on a 30-year fixed-rate mortgage was unchanged, the rate on the 15-year fixed was unchanged and the rate on the 5/1 ARM went up one basis point, according to a NerdWallet survey.With an interest only mortgage you pay only interest and no principal during the for the first 3, 5, 7 or 10 years of the loan, which is called the interest only period. Additionally, your interest rate is fixed and does not change during the interest only period.

The 30-year fixed-rate loan is the most common term in the United States, but as the economy has went through more frequent booms & busts this century it can make sense to purchase a smaller home with a 15-year mortgage. If a home buyer opts for a 30-year loan, most of their early payments will go toward interest on the loan.
